commit | 229d0cfae5b21bfc42525cf43b0b4279243acc4e | [log] [tgz] |
---|---|---|
author | Masahiro Yamada <masahiroy@kernel.org> | Fri Oct 01 14:32:44 2021 +0900 |
committer | Masahiro Yamada <masahiroy@kernel.org> | Fri Oct 01 17:28:17 2021 +0900 |
tree | 46de5d2794e9f067e749db5d914beabbc4c02a10 | |
parent | 6988f70cf105e70b4ea424d320521a9ed452fe46 [diff] |
kconfig: remove 'const' from the return type of sym_escape_string_value() sym_escape_string_value() returns a malloc'ed memory, but as (const char *). So, it must be casted to (void *) when it is free'd. This is odd. The return type of sym_escape_string_value() should be (char *). I exploited that free(NULL) has no effect. Signed-off-by: Masahiro Yamada <masahiroy@kernel.org>